Free vibration analysis of annular sector plates via conical shell equations

Çiğdem DemirHakan ErsoyKadir MercanÖmer Civalek — 2017

Curved and Layered Structures

In this paper, free vibration analysis of annular sector plates has been presented via conical shell equations. By using the first-order shear deformation theory (FSDT) equation of motion of conical shell is obtained. The method of discrete singular convolution (DSC) and method differential quadrature (DQ) are used for solution of the vibration problem of annular plates for some special value of semi-vertex angle via conical shell equation.
